January 2011 Special Event
Ozark Angels Hatchery Tour
Saturday, January 8, 2011, 3:00 PM
Come see over a million fish!
Image
We've got something extra special planned for January 8th.
The folks at Ozark Angels hatchery have graciously offered to give us a tour of their facility! Ozark Angels is a 20,000 square foot indoor hatchery breeding angelfish, oscars, and fancy guppies. With approximately 400 breeding pairs of angelfish, 150 breeding oscars, and too many guppy moms to count, there are over a million fish to see!

You will have a chance to see a real commercial tropical fish breeding operation in action. It will be a great opportunity to ask questions and learn. Everyone is invited. There is no charge for the tour.
